1913-S Eagle, MS64
Low-Mintage Rarity
1913-S $10 MS64 NGC. CAC. The 1913-S Indian ten had a low
mintage of 66,000 coins and many of those apparently entered
circulation as the average certified grade is AU55. The average
grade can be somewhat misleading, as the emphasis is always on
submitting higher value (i.e. higher grade) coins. Many old-time
collections contained examples of the 1913-S that graded just VF or
XF. This Choice Mint State piece ranks among the finer known
examples. In act, NGC and PCGS have only certified seven finer
pieces. A lovely lemon-yellow example, this piece has brilliant
satin luster and pristine surfaces. Census: 11 in 64, 3 finer. CAC:
5 in 64, 1 finer (11/19).From The Kodiak Collection. (Registry values: N7079)
Coin Index Numbers: (NGC ID# 28GZ, PCGS# 8874, Greysheet# 9769)
Metal: 90% Gold, 10% Copper
Weight: 16.72 grams
AGW: 0.53oz
Mintage: 66,000
